FAQs

WHAT IS THE COST?

Here is the cost analysis as a rule of thumb: For example how many 6” inch x 8” inch PCB boards can be coated with 1 liter of V2 Solution? Calculation is based on surface area - general rule is using the square inch of the PCB board x 0.16. Eg: 6 x 8 = 48 x 0.16 = 7.68 ml consumption rate - depending on the price per liter you sell for will be the price to coat each unit.

WHAT IS THE EXPECTED EVAPORATION RATE?

Evaporation rate is about 1ml per 10 min based on the sample tray size at ambient. The evaporation rate is 0.0357 mL / cm^2/ hour. However, this will vary depending on the type of board disturbing the surface of the solution and also the solution's exposed area. After 5 hours total time of dipping boards using the same solution, it is recommended to purchase more solution as the solvent will evaporate off to the point where the solution is too concentrated. However, this can be experimentally streamlined if you want to use the same solution as one can continuously dilute the solution to maintain a specific concentration range
